Comparing Glass to Other Kettle Materials

Material Comparison: Glass vs. Others

When it comes to choosing a kettle for your coffee or tea needs, the material is a crucial factor. Glass coffee kettles, often made from borosilicate glass, are celebrated for their aesthetic appeal and the ability to see the water boiling. But how do they stack up against other materials like stainless steel or ceramic?

Glass kettles, such as those made from German glass or brands like Trendglas Jena, offer a sleek, modern look. They are heat resistant and allow you to monitor the water level and boiling process, which can be particularly useful for precise brewing methods like pour-over coffee.

Stainless steel kettles, on the other hand, are known for their durability and heat retention. They are less prone to breaking compared to glass and often come with additional features like temperature control. Products like the Fellow Stagg EKG or EKG Pro are popular choices for those seeking precision in temperature.

Ceramic kettles provide a traditional aesthetic and excellent heat retention but are generally heavier and more prone to chipping compared to their glass and stainless steel counterparts.

  • Heat Resistance: Glass and stainless steel are both heat resistant, but glass allows for visual monitoring.
  • Durability: Stainless steel is more durable than glass, which can shatter if dropped.
  • Aesthetic: Glass offers a modern, clean look, while ceramic provides a classic style.
  • Price: Stainless steel and glass kettles are often similarly priced, though high-end models like the Stagg EKG can be more expensive.

When considering a kettle, think about your specific needs. If you value aesthetics and the ability to see your water boil, a glass kettle might be the best choice. However, if durability and additional features like temperature control are more important, stainless steel could be the way to go.

Maintenance and Care for Glass Coffee Kettles

Proper Care for Long-Lasting Use

Maintaining your glass coffee kettle is essential to ensure it remains in top condition, providing you with the best coffee and tea experiences. Whether you have an electric kettle or a stovetop model, taking care of your kettle involves a few key steps.

Cleaning Your Glass Kettle

Regular cleaning is crucial for keeping your glass coffee kettle free from stains and mineral deposits. Use a mixture of vinegar and water to descale the kettle, especially if you use it frequently for boiling water. This method is effective for both electric kettles and stovetop models. Ensure you rinse thoroughly after cleaning to remove any vinegar residue.

Handle with Care

Glass kettles, particularly those made from borosilicate glass, are known for their heat resistance. However, it's important to handle them with care to prevent accidental breakage. Always use the handle when pouring hot water or coffee, and avoid sudden temperature changes that could stress the glass.

Storage Tips

When not in use, store your glass coffee kettle in a safe place where it won't be knocked over or exposed to extreme temperatures. If your kettle comes with a lid, ensure it's securely placed to keep dust and debris out.

Regular Inspection

Inspect your kettle regularly for any signs of wear or damage. Check the handle, spout, and lid for any loose parts. For electric models, ensure the base and cord are in good condition. Addressing minor issues promptly can prevent larger problems down the line.

By following these maintenance tips, your glass coffee kettle can serve you well for years, offering the perfect cup of coffee or tea every time.
